Sunrise Beach: West Side Quiet
Sunrise Beach is a quieter residential community on the west side of the lake, popular with full-time residents and retirees. Large lots, beautiful main-channel views in the MM 30-to-40 stretch, and a slightly slower pace than Osage Beach or Lake Ozark.
Waterfront in Sunrise Beach mixes main-channel and Big Niangua Arm exposure. Channel-side properties typically run heavier dock construction with breakwaters; Niangua-side properties have the option of lighter, simpler builds. Either way, rip rap and steady dock maintenance are the norm.
